Cardinal Health Reports First-quarter Results for Fiscal Year 2018
November 6, 2017 6:45 AM ESTDUBLIN, Ohio, Nov. 6, 2017 /PRNewswire/ --Â Cardinal Health (NYSE: CAH) today reported first-quarter fiscal year 2018 revenues of $32.6 billion, an increase of 2 percent. The company also reported a decline in GAAP operating earnings of 51 percent to $262 million and in non-GAAP operating earnings of 9 percent to $610 million. GAAP diluted earnings per share (EPS) decreased 63 percent to $0.36, while non-GAAP diluted EPS decreased 12 percent to $1.09.
